  • Boutique riverside retreat: From humble beginnings as a 16th-century coaching inn, The Relais Henley has undergone many a reinvention to transform it into what it is today. A cosy yet stylish boutique on the banks of the River Thames, behind its wisteria-clad façade you’ll find individually designed guest rooms that capture a country-chic spirit and the natural botanic beauty of the Chiltern Valley.

  • Savour seasonal British fare: Savour seasonal British fare: British seasonal classics await at the newly opened Restaurant Dominic Chapman. Tuck in to the likes of Cornish crab salad, rib of Hereford beef, steamed Scottish halibut, and lemon meringue pie. There’s also the Deli, a café-style pantry where you can enjoy cakes, pastries, coffee and soft drinks as well as local, organic products.

  • Tempting tipples at every turn: The intimate Quarterdeck Bar, tucked away in the oldest part of the building, has been revamped to bring the best of contemporary style and vintage pub vibes together on one place. Ideal for early evening aperitifs, sip a martini or locally distilled gin in the comfort of one of the plush armchairs or velvet sofa’s. There’s also The Courtyard, the perfect spot for alfresco dining and drinking during the warmer months.

How to get there

The hotel sits in the town of Henley-on-Thames, on the cusp of the Chiltern Hills. You’ll find yourself 30 minutes from Reading, and 20 minutes from Junction 8 of the M4. The nearest train station is a 10-minute walk away. From London, take the train to Twyford from Paddington, then change towards Henley-on-Thames.

Location and what's nearby

static map

Hart St, Henley-on-Thames RG9 2AR

Henley-on-Thames is a charming, quiet town, perfect for long rambling walks along the river, afternoons spent sipping locally-brewed beers (the Rebellion Brewery is in Marlow, 20 minutes away) or days exploring the surrounding Chiltern Hills and National Trust properties. Grey’s Court, a Tudor manor, is less than 10 minutes down the road, while Cliveden House is a 30-minute drive. If you fancy exploring even further, the Gothic architecture of Oxford’s University is less than an hour away.
